In a troubling incident that unfolded in Chicago over the weekend, an undocumented immigrant was taken into custody following an alleged altercation with Border Patrol agents. The incident has reignited the debate surrounding the urgent need for comprehensive immigration reform, as well as increased accountability and oversight within law enforcement agencies.
While details of the incident remain unclear, it is essential to approach this situation with empathy and a commitment to justice for all individuals involved. The alleged actions of the undocumented individual, who is reported to have a prior felony firearm violation, should not be used to perpetuate harmful stereotypes or justify the inhumane treatment of immigrant communities.
This incident underscores the systemic failures of our current immigration system, which often criminalizes and marginalizes undocumented individuals instead of providing them with viable pathways to legal status and social support. The presence of Border Patrol agents in Chicago, a city that has long championed immigrant rights and declared itself a sanctuary for undocumented individuals, raises serious concerns about the overreach of federal immigration enforcement and its impact on community trust and public safety.
Moreover, the alleged use of force by Border Patrol agents in this incident demands a thorough and transparent investigation to ensure that their actions were justified and proportionate. Law enforcement agencies must be held accountable for their conduct and should prioritize de-escalation and community-oriented policing practices.
As we grapple with the complexities of this case, it is crucial to recognize the larger socioeconomic and political factors that contribute to the marginalization of immigrant communities. We must address the root causes of migration, such as poverty, violence, and climate change, while also working to dismantle the systems of oppression and discrimination that disproportionately impact people of color and undocumented individuals.
Moving forward, we must prioritize compassionate and equitable solutions that uphold the human rights and dignity of all individuals, regardless of their immigration status. This includes advocating for comprehensive immigration reform that provides a pathway to citizenship for undocumented individuals, investing in community-based alternatives to detention and deportation, and ensuring that law enforcement agencies are transparent, accountable, and committed to serving and protecting all members of our society.
